Foros del Web » Creando para Internet » Flash y Actionscript »

Necesito explicación de este código

Estas en el tema de Necesito explicación de este código en el foro de Flash y Actionscript en Foros del Web. El código es este: @import url("http://static.forosdelweb.com/clientscript/vbulletin_css/geshi.css"); Código AS: Ver original function buildMap(map) {     _root.elevador.tiles.attachMovie("empty", "tiles", 1);     _root.elevador.tiles.tiles.attachMovie("mouse", "mouse", 2);     ...
  #1 (permalink)  
Antiguo 30/05/2011, 10:33
 
Fecha de Ingreso: octubre-2010
Mensajes: 77
Antigüedad: 8 años
Puntos: 1
Necesito explicación de este código

El código es este:
Código AS:
Ver original
  1. function buildMap(map)
  2. {
  3.     _root.elevador.tiles.attachMovie("empty", "tiles", 1);
  4.     _root.elevador.tiles.tiles.attachMovie("mouse", "mouse", 2);
  5.     _root.elevador.tiles.bubble.swapDepths(4);
  6.     _root.elevador.tiles.tiles.attachMovie("empty", "back", 0);
  7.     var _loc6 = map[0].length;
  8.     var _loc7 = map.length;
  9.     _global.mapWidth = _loc6;
  10.     _global.mapHeight = _loc7;
  11.     for (var _loc4 = 0; _loc4 < _loc7; ++_loc4)
  12.     {
  13.         for (var _loc3 = 0; _loc3 < _loc6; ++_loc3)
  14.         {
  15.             var _loc5 = "t_" + _loc4 + "_" + _loc3;
  16.             depth = (_loc3 + _loc4) * _global.tileW / 2 * 300 + (_loc3 - _loc4) * _global.tileW + 1;
  17.             tiler = _root.elevador.tiles.tiles.attachMovie("tile", _loc5, depth);
  18.             tiler.alto = 0;
  19.             tiler.altura = 0;
  20.             tiler.depth = depth;
  21.             tiler._x = (_loc3 - _loc4) * _global.tileW;
  22.             tiler._y = (_loc3 + _loc4) * _global.tileW / 2;
  23.             tiler.gotoAndStop(1);
  24.         } // end of for
  25.     } // end of for
  26.     var _loc9 = char;
  27. } // End of the function

Hace que puedas mover a un personaje estilo habbo. Es decir, pones el ratón donde te quieres mover, y aparece un recuadro marcándote donde vas a ir.

El problema es que el movieclip del recuadro se ha borrado el nombre, y no se que nombre llevaba antes (tiler, elevador, tileW, etc...)

Etiquetas: as3
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 17:32.